I flip through some sites, and today he's confirmed that he's getting a divorce after 24 years of marriage:Days after he was involved in a serious car accident, a friend of “Dark Knight” star Morgan Freeman confirmed to Access Hollywood that the actor is getting a divorce.
Freeman and his wife of 24-years, costumer Myrna Colley-Lee, “are involved in a divorce action,” the actor’s Mississippi-based attorney and business partner Bill Luckett told Access Hollywood. “And for legal and practical purposes, [Freeman and Colley-Lee] have been separated since December of 2007.”
As previously reported on AccessHollywood.com, Freeman was involved in an accident over the weekend, which saw the car he was driving flip. The actor and his female passenger, identified as Demaris Meyer, were driving on Mississippi Highway 32 in a rural area of Tallahatchie County at 11:30 PM on Sunday evening, when Freeman’s car went off the right side of the road and flipped over.
Freeman and Meyer, who has been described as the actor’s friend, were on the way to Freeman’s home when the accident occurred.

Just checking the 'Net, saw that Morgan Freeman has had surgery today, following the accident he was in on Sunday. People reports:"Morgan is doing well after his surgery last night to reconnect nerves and repair damage in his left arm and hand," his spokesperson, Donna Lee, said in a statement Tuesday.
"The surgery last night lasted four and a half hours. He's visiting with family this morning. As of this morning he's up and walking around and looking forward to his release in a few days."
Mac Edwards, a consultant for Freeman's Ground Zero Blues Club, spoke with the actor's business partner in that venture on Tuesday.
The partner, who is visiting with Freeman in the hosital, reported, "Morgan is up and walking around. He's really sore, but he's doing better. He's hoping to be out of the hospital by Thursday."
